LEWISTOWN — The Mifflin County boys lacrosse team battled Chambersburg on Thursday but fell 18-5.
In the first quarter, Chambersburg fought through the Huskies, scoring four points. Easton Zook and Raul Rodriguez were the lone scorers in the first quarter, both scoring one point. By the end of the first quarter the score was 4-2.
In the second quarter, Chambersburg dominated the Huskies and scored 10 points.
The Huskies had one lone scorer in Dodger Weaver as he corralled one point, making the end of the second quarter 14-3.
The third quarter was calm after halftime. The Huskies scored one point with Easton Zook scoring the point. Chambersburg scored three points during the third quarter, making the score 17-4.
In the final quarter, Dakota Gibbons was the Huskies’ lone scorer, scoring one point. Chambersburg also scored one point in the fourth quarter. The final score of the game was 18-5 with Chambersburg coming out on top.
Brett Rogers, the coach of the Huskies, stated, “We held them back since the last time we played them. We held them back, making them score less than last time.” He later stated, “When you’re down 15 points just to continue playing always helps.”
The Huskies are 3-9 on the season right now, their next game will be on Tuesday at 7:30.

Huskies pummel Rockets
ALTOONA — Mifflin County strolled past Southern Huntingdon for an 11-1 victory at PNG Field on Thursday afternoon.
For the Huskies, Madden Weaver posted an RBI and Jayden Smith tallied two hits and three runs.
Karl Shirey blasted a home run, added three hits and four RBIs. Luke Shawver and Chase Hartung each posted one ribbie. McKnight had three ribbies.
Austin McKnight and Shirey each had a triple. Smith (two) and Ezra Beamer each had one double.
Smith, Parker Crownover and Kooper Walters each stole one base.
On the mound, Wyatt Parkes hurled five innings, allowed seven hits, one run, three walks and had five strikeouts.
Cohen Leister tossed one frame and struck out two batters.
For the Rockets, Jackson Parks had two hits and Cory Pershing had an RBI.
The Huskies (8-4) are in the Altoona Curve Invite today.

Huskies nudge Mustangs, 16-11
LEWISTOWN — Mifflin County outlasted West Perry on Thursday, 16-11, and have won two games in a row.
The Huskies overcame a 6-1 deficit by posting four runs in the third frame.
After the Trojans scored three times in the fourth, making it 9-5, they added two more runs in the fifth (11-5 at that point).
Then, the Huskies tallied six runs in the fifth stanza to tie the game at 11.
The Huskies would tack on five more runs in the sixth to achieve victory.
The Huskies had 19 hits and four errors. The Trojans tallied seven hits and no errors.
The Lady Huskies (3-9) visit Chambersburg on Tuesday.
